Why IT Services Matter in Healthcare

Healthcare operations go beyond doctor-patient visits. Clinics, diagnostic centres, and hospitals must manage patient records, schedule appointments, handle billing, process insurance claims, control inventory, generate reports, and ensure compliance — often at the same time. When these processes depend on manual systems or old software, it leads to slower service, more mistakes, and unhappy patients.

Healthcare IT solutions solve this problem by bringing these services together on a secure, dependable, and user-friendly platform. They help make the best use of resources, cut down on human mistakes, and give healthcare teams quick, safe access to patient information when they need it most.

Key Healthcare IT Solutions That Boost Efficiency

To tackle growing operational challenges, healthcare facilities are using several IT services. Here are the ones that have the biggest impact:

  • Electronic Health Record (EHR) Systems : An EHR system stores patient data in digital form, allowing doctors, nurses, and staff to access it right away. It cuts down on paperwork, helps plan treatments better, and boosts communication across different parts of a hospital.

  • Hospital Management Software : New hospital management software brings together all departments — from the front desk and labs to the pharmacy and billing — into one smooth-running system. This tool helps make better choices, cuts back on paperwork, and manages resources well while keeping data correct.

  • Telemedicine and Virtual Healthcare Platforms : Online check-ups are now a must for far-off areas or healthcare after the pandemic. These platforms let healthcare workers talk to patients online, handle e-prescriptions, and look at patient files during virtual visits.

  • Data Security & Compliance Solutions : Protecting patient data from breaches is crucial when dealing with sensitive information. Healthcare IT services provide encryption, multi-factor authentication, secure backups, and role-based access control to safeguard confidential records and follow data privacy laws.

  • Healthcare Analytics & Reporting : Modern healthcare tech solutions now include data analytics tools to monitor patient trends, service quality, appointment scheduling efficiency, and financial performance. These insights enable management teams to make smart, data-backed decisions.

Benefits of Adopting Healthcare IT Services

Putting healthcare IT systems into action brings major advantages for hospitals, clinics, and diagnostic centres:

  • Less Administrative Work: Automating routine tasks such as billing, scheduling, and record-keeping lets medical staff dedicate more time to patient care.

  • Better Patient Experience: Quicker service, shorter wait times Easy health record access and smooth communication result in happier patients.

  • Data Security Compliance: IT solutions help hospitals meet tough regulatory rules to protect sensitive health information.

  • Improved Operational Control: Up-to-the-minute data and reports allow management teams to monitor performance, fix operational slowdowns, and plan resources well.

  • Money Savings: Automating processes cuts down on paperwork, staff time, and mistakes — saving money over time.

FAQs About Healthcare Tech Tools

Q1. What are healthcare IT solutions?

Healthcare IT solutions consist of software and digital services that have an impact on managing, storing, and securing patient records. They also help to automate administrative tasks, support telehealth services, and make hospital and clinic operations run better.

Q2. How do IT services improve healthcare practice efficiency?

They have an influence on automating everyday tasks like scheduling, billing, inventory, and record management. These services cut down on paperwork, keep data safe, and allow for quicker and more precise communication between staff and patients.

Q3. What is hospital management software?

Hospital management software is a digital platform to integrate various hospital functions into one effective system. These functions include signing up patients, handling bills, managing the pharmacy and lab, scheduling staff, and creating reports.

Q4. Are healthcare IT services secure?

Yes. Good IT providers build systems with top-notch security features to protect sensitive patient data and follow regulatory standards. These features include encryption, multi-step authentication, and access based on job roles.
